Description
Santorini is the first wine ever produced by Vas- saltis. Made from 100% Assyrtiko this is the most well known wine of the winery. Produced by both whole bunch and destemmed grapes, the wine ferments in steel tanks where it remains with its lees for 7 months prior to its bottling and release to the market
An exceptionally complete wine with a great ageing potential, shows the true essence of what Santorini and Assyrtiko are about: Aromatics of basalt and pumice stone with ripe tropical fruits, honeysuckle and maritime salinity, and a palate of salty green fruits with high levels of minerality and acidity. The long aftertaste adds depth and weight to the wine making it a perfect pairing for seafood and fish.
Colour: Straw Yellow
Nose: Flint, iodine, citrus, herbs, bread, complexity
Taste: Refreshing acidity, full bodied, creamy,
minearlity, citrus, long after-taste
Ageing potential: 7 years.
